‘Santa Elena en bus’ to be released soon in national cinemas

Posted On 24 Oct 2012

“Severino, A bus driver, travels across the province of Santa Elena, to witness the birth of his first child. On the way, he encounters several obstacles that make  it more difficult to reach his destination; facing his own fears  he leads us to understand that in the sunset of our lives, only love remains. “

Santa Elena en Bus

Santa Elena en Bus

This is the synopsis of ‘Santa Elena en Bus’ a movie written, filmed and performed by young people from 12 different communities of the province of Santa Elena who, within a framework of free, film and acting workshops, produced this movie with the promotion of  Filmarte Production Company.

For this realization, about 49 participants, aged between 14 and 41 years old, took free workshops about films and acting, as a  part of a project of the National Film Board (CN Cinema). After four vocational workshops, in four rural communities, with four local themes, these young rookies on cinematography, wrote four screenplays for a fiction short film based on myths, legends and traditions of each community.

This resulted in ‘Santa Elena en Bus’, which tells the story of a bus driver who stops and picks interparochial passengers in the communities portrayed in each short film. A plot that revolves around life and death,  with love as the center of the entire film, performed with humor, some sadness and terror”.
